Transaction 34fc8665be77739bc56a79aded4e840a326bc859dc02f8d2008c2ccd16e48b57
2 Input
2 Outputs
- 34fc8665be77739bc56a79aded4e840a326bc859dc02f8d2008c2ccd16e48b57:0
- 34fc8665be77739bc56a79aded4e840a326bc859dc02f8d2008c2ccd16e48b57:1
value 1367456
address 3QiNCfErrAkNdoRLKgintaKpUk8zgW4r6K
value 10897513
address 1EcVqWAWeyAQmeF5DF5JtfG3o6jdCgpCSr